5 Grappoli Bibenda

The 5 Grappoli ('Bunches' in English) Bibenda is the most prestigious award for Italian wine assigned by the Italian Sommelier Foundation, also known by its acronym FIS. Founded in Rome in 2013, it is the author of an important annual guide with a history spanning more than 20 years. The Bibenda guide, which has been published since 1999 by passionate sommeliers under the guidance of Franco Maria Ricci, is one of the most influential food and wine review publications that, every year, awards the highest recognition to products that are considered excellent, having achieved a score of over 91/100 in the tasting phase. These are great, unmissable expressions of Italy's wine-growing heritage, testifying to the country's standards of excellence.

The Important Recognition of the 5 Grappoli

The publication of the guide, featuring the wines that have achieved this prestigious recognition, is carried out by the Italian Sommelier Federation. It was created in 2013 as a result of the separation between the Italian Association of Sommeliers and the Rome branch led by Franco Maria Ricci, which then independently re-established itself. Starting with the 2015 edition, the guide has therefore become the voice of the FIS and the team of sommeliers led by president Franco Maria Ricci, who founded and directed it since 1998.

The rating is the result of several tasting sessions carried out at the headquarters in Rome. The samples tasted are either sent in by producers or, more rarely, found in wine shops or restaurants. The best bottles, i.e. those that demonstrate excellent quality from an organoleptic point of view, are admitted to a final tasting session, during which the sommeliers decide on the awarding of the 5 Grappoli Bibenda prize.

Around 20,000 samples from 20,000 Italian wineries are currently being tasted. Out of these, more than 600 wine varieties are awarded and reviewed in the guide. These numbers alone are enough to give an idea of the huge amount of work that goes into the publication of the guide, which year after year is becoming increasingly complete and comprehensive. In fact, all types of wine produced at national level are taken into consideration: from Moscato, which is notoriously one of the most popular wines, to reds, passiti, whites, fortified wines and Nero d'Avola!

The final tasting phase takes place every year in July, August and September, while the guide is published during the autumn. This publication summarises scores on a scale of 100 obtained from the bottles reviewed:

  • Rating of 5 / 91 to 100 / excellence
  • Rating of 4 / 85 to 90 / high level and outstanding merit
  • Rating of 3 / from 80 to 84 / good level and particular finesse
  • Rating of 2 / 74 to 79 / medium level and pleasant quality

In addition to the wines, grappa and extra virgin olive oil are also reviewed according to the same criteria. The publication of the awards is complemented by a fact sheet with a full organoleptic description and suggested pairings. The Excellence of the Italian Wine Scene

Thanks to the publication of the guide and the 5 Grappoli award, sommeliers have been able to promote and offer the excellence of Italian wine to an ever wider public. Over the years, these have been the best expressions of all the various types produced in the Italian peninsula: not only world famous masterpieces such as Brunello di Montalcino, a red wine from Tuscany produced in the province of Siena, or Barolo, but also rarer and more exclusive wines.

Some wines, benefiting from the prestigious recognition, have imposed themselves as iconic expressions and points of reference, dominating the market. This is the case, for example, of Lambrusco Otello Nero of Cantina Ceci, which was the first Lambrusco to obtain the maximum score in the history of the guide, and which has received it for several successive editions. The evaluation is carried out taking into account all the characteristics found during the tasting, which can be classified into three macro-categories: visual, olfactory and taste-olfactory. The perfect coherence between the various characteristics, together with final observations focused mainly on the evaluation of the level of quality and territorial typicality, determine the assignment of the final score. This is carried out by a team of competent and experienced sommeliers. The publication of the guide and the awards is anticipated each year by a list of the 10 best entries. This is a highly anticipated preview that highlights, among the various labels that have achieved the highest recognition, 10 absolute leaders in their category. In this regard, the editors have declared: "We are talking about wines that, in addition to having obtained the 5 Grappoli, have most impressed us, touched our sensibilities and conveyed great emotions". With these rankings and awards, the sommeliers have confirmed to wine-lovers that the level of quality in Italy is constantly improving, demonstrating that even wine-growing regions once considered second class are now producing great excellence.
